Documentation of define_1950-93_clim


Global Index (short | long) | Local contents | Local Index (short | long)


Cross-Reference Information

This script calls

Listing of script define_1950-93_clim


clear
cd /home/disk/hayes/dvimont/ccm3.6/data/OI_RUN
sst = getnc('sst_jan1978-sep1993.nc', 'SST');
[lat, lon] = getll('sst_jan1978-sep1993.nc');
sstclim = sst(1:12,:,:);
sstcur = sst(25:189,:,:);
[sstcur, climcur] = annave(sstcur);
cd /home/disk/hayes/dvimont/ccm3.6/data/GR
sst5079 = getnc('sst5079t31.nc', 'SST');
[lat31, lon31] = getll('sst5079t31.nc');
for i = 1:12;
  sst8093(i,:,:) = interp2(lon, lat, squeeze(climcur(i,:,:)), lon31, lat31');
end
default_global
tem = squeeze(mean(climcur - sstclim));
w = (79 - 50 + 1) / (93 - 50 + 1);
clim = w * sst5079 + (1 - w) * sst8093;
tem = squeeze(mean(clim - sstclim));
cd /home/disk/hayes/dvimont/ccm3.6/data/GR
nc = netcdf('sst5093t31.nc', 'write');
  sstold = nc{'SST'}(:,:,:);
  icpt = find(clim <= -1.799);
  clim(icpt) = -1.8 * ones(size(icpt));
  nc{'SST'}(:,:,:) = clim;
nc = close(nc);